Live Stream: EIE and TechCrunch Edinburgh #tcedin #eie10

TechCrunch Europe is co-locating with Engage, Invest, Exploit ’10 in Edinburgh today. Our venue hosts will be holding the EIE event in the morning and in the afternoon TechCrunch Europe will be running a more TC style event, TechCrunch Edinburgh.

The room is full of startups and VCs. This morning we’re hearing pitches from some more developed startups in the morning, ranging from internet tech to cleantech to energy companies. Twitter hashtags are #tcedin and #eie10.

4iP


4iP is Channel 4’s innovation fund to stimulate public service digital media across the UK. In English, that means supporting great ideas for disruptive websites, games and mobile services which help people improve their lives. 4iP aspires to be the riskiest and highest value add investor in the UK. Last year 4iP did over 30 deals including Audioboo, MyBuilder, GymFu, Newspaper Club and Mapumental. www.4ip.org.uk
